New Forest Covid fines – car wash company open illegally and men found drinking outside pub

A HAND car wash company found illegally operating was among two incidents in the New Forest which led police to fine three people for breaching Covid-19 restrictions.

Officers attended the business in Ringwood Road, Woodlands, last Saturday in response to reports it was contravening the current Health Protection regulations.

A 33-year-old local man was reported for summons in relation to a fixed penalty notice for a breach of Covid-19 regulations.

On the same day, officers issued penalty notices to two men found drinking alcohol and listening to music outside the Saxon Inn pub in Calmore Drive, Calmore.

A Facebook post by police about the incident said both men had previously been warned about this type of behaviour.
